2017 Premiership Rugby Sevens Series

Content sourced from Wikipedia, licensed under CC BY-SA 3.0.

The 2017 Singha Premiership Rugby Sevens Series was the eighth national sevens competition for the 12 Premiership clubs in the 2017–18 season. It was the first time since 2013 that Welsh Regions were not involved and it introduced a new format with all 12 teams playing at one venue over two days.

The event took place at Franklin's Gardens in Northampton on July 28–29, 2017. Twelve teams were split into four groups (A–D). In the group stage, each team played the others in its group. The group winners and runners-up moved to the quarter-finals, while the third-placed teams went to the bowl semi-finals.

From the knockout rounds, the quarter-final winners went to the cup semi-finals and the losers moved to the plate. The remaining four teams played in the bowl competition. The cup winner was crowned the series champion.

Finals day was on July 29 at Franklin's Gardens. The champions were Wasps 7s and the runners-up were Newcastle Falcons 7s, with a total of 25 matches played.
